NUR 423 Global Health Care

This course focuses on health care needs of aggregates in local, national, and international communities from the perspective of primary, secondary, and tertiary prevention. Students explore a variety of frameworks such as epidemiology, health care systems, and health care planning as conceptual bases for diverse community health nursing roles.  MANDATORY: All students preparing to begin this course must have a current,  unencumbered and active RN license on file in their credentialing profile.
